Job Summary

  • The Technical Product Manager – Platform role is a hands-on business-to-technology focused role and is an integral part of the Charles River software platform.
  • The Platform team plays a crucial role in enabling development teams to build using consistent technologies and underlying infrastructure, support and operations teams to operate the application environments at the expected service levels and the transition to cloud native approaches.
